Core Responsibilities
•Conduct comprehensive psychiatric evaluations and mental health assessments
•Develop and monitor individualized treatment plans
•Prescribe and manage psychotropic medications
•Provide patient and family education on diagnoses and treatment
•Collaborate with therapists, case managers, schools, and external providers
•Participate in clinical team meetings and case reviews
•Document all services accurately in the electronic health record (EHR)
•Maintain compliance with legal, ethical, and professional standards
•Stay informed on best practices in adolescent psychiatry
Qualifications
•Certified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ner (PMHNP)
•Active, unrestricted Arizona NP license
•Minimum 1 year of experience working with adolescents or substance use populations
•Strong background in trauma-informed and collaborative care models
•Effective communication and documentation skills
•Comfortable navigating both virtual and in-person clinical settings
